5. LinkedIn
LinkedIn is a professional networking site that can be incredibly useful for finding sole proprietors looking for partners. You can join specific groups, network with professionals in your industry, and reach out directly to potential partners. The combination of targeted searches and engaging with the broader network can yield fruitful results.
The Importance of Networking Extensively
While these platforms offer a wealth of opportunities, the true essence lies in the connections you build. Here are some tips to help you network effectively:
Attend Industry Events: Participate in conferences, workshops, and networking events to meet potential partners in person. Utilize Social Media: Engage with professionals on LinkedIn, Twitter, and other social media platforms to build your online presence and establish connections. Join Online Forums: Participate in industry-specific forums and online communities to connect with like-minded individuals.
